1. Broker Overview
ActiveX Markets, established in 2023, is a forex broker that operates primarily in the online trading space. The company claims to be headquartered in the United Kingdom; however, it has been flagged for operating without proper regulatory authorization. ActiveX Markets is a private entity, which means it is not publicly traded on any stock exchange.
The broker serves a diverse clientele, including retail traders interested in forex, commodities, and cryptocurrency markets. Despite its claims of reliability and customer service, ActiveX Markets has raised several red flags due to its lack of regulation and transparency. The company has been noted for its aggressive marketing strategies, which may mislead potential clients regarding its operational legitimacy.
ActiveX Markets has positioned itself as a multi-asset trading platform, allowing users to engage in various financial instruments. However, the absence of a solid regulatory framework poses significant risks for traders. The business model primarily focuses on retail forex trading but also includes services for institutional clients.
ActiveX Markets operates without any major regulatory oversight, which is a significant concern for potential investors. The broker does not hold licenses from recognized financial authorities, including the United Kingdom's Financial Conduct Authority (FCA). The FCA has issued warnings against ActiveX Markets, stating that it is not authorized to provide financial services in the UK.
The lack of regulatory oversight means there are no guarantees regarding client fund protection, and the broker does not maintain segregated accounts for client funds. ActiveX Markets also does not participate in any investor compensation schemes, further increasing the risk for traders.
The broker claims to follow Know Your Customer (KYC) and Anti-Money Laundering (AML) guidelines; however, the effectiveness of these measures cannot be verified due to the absence of regulatory scrutiny. This lack of transparency raises concerns about the safety of client funds and the overall integrity of the trading environment.
3. Trading Products and Services
ActiveX Markets offers a variety of trading products, including:
- Forex Pairs: The broker provides access to over 50 currency pairs, including major, minor, and exotic pairs.
- CFDs: ActiveX Markets allows trading in Contracts for Difference (CFDs) across various asset classes such as indices, commodities, and cryptocurrencies.
- Cryptocurrencies: The broker claims to offer trading in popular cryptocurrencies, although the specific offerings are not clearly defined.
The product range is subject to frequent updates, but the lack of regulatory oversight means there is no assurance regarding the quality or reliability of these products. ActiveX Markets primarily focuses on retail trading services, which may not cater to the needs of institutional clients looking for more sophisticated trading options.
ActiveX Markets claims to support popular trading platforms, including MetaTrader 4 (MT4) and MetaTrader 5 (MT5). However, there are concerns regarding the actual functionality and reliability of these platforms. The broker also mentions a proprietary trading platform, but details about its features and performance are limited.
The broker offers a web-based trading platform that is accessible from various devices, including mobile applications for iOS and Android. The execution model is not explicitly defined, which raises questions about the trading conditions offered by ActiveX Markets.
Furthermore, the broker's technological infrastructure is reportedly lacking in advanced features, which may hinder the trading experience for users seeking robust analytical tools and automated trading options.
5. Account Types and Trading Conditions
ActiveX Markets provides several account types, with the following conditions:
- Standard Account: Requires a minimum deposit of $100, with spreads starting from 0.7 pips. The commission structure is not clearly defined.
- Premium Account: Higher minimum deposit requirements with potentially better trading conditions, although specific details are not provided.
- Islamic Account: Offered for traders seeking Sharia-compliant trading options.
Leverage is advertised as high as 1:500, which is significantly above the levels permitted by regulated brokers in many jurisdictions. This high leverage can amplify both profits and losses, increasing the risk for traders. The minimum trade size and overnight fees are not clearly specified, which can complicate trading strategies for clients.
6. Fund Management
ActiveX Markets supports various deposit methods, including bank transfers, credit cards, and electronic wallets. The minimum deposit requirement varies by account type, with the standard account starting at $100.
Deposit processing times can range from instant to several business days, depending on the method chosen. However, specific details about any associated fees for deposits are not clearly outlined, leaving potential clients in the dark about the cost of funding their accounts.
Withdrawal methods are also available, but the broker does not provide clear information on withdrawal processing times or any potential fees. This lack of transparency can be a significant drawback for traders who prioritize easy access to their funds.
